What Is Dual Thermal Protection in a Water Heater and Why Is It Important?

Many low-end water heaters rely on single-layer thermal protection. If that fails, overheating can go unnoticed. This is dangerous. Haier uses Dual Thermal Proof (TTS) protection in its ESTILE model. It triggers the first cut-off at 75°C. If that layer fails, the second control shuts power at 95°C.

This is an example of water heater safety featuresthat prevent heat damage to the internal tank, pipe seals, and heating elements. The tank does not burst. The thermostat does not melt. You do not face temperature-related accidents.

How Do Built-in Safety Valves Protect Your Water Heater from High Water Pressure?

Water pressure is another silent hazard. In high-rise homes, geysers face incoming water pressure from gravity-based tank flows or pressure pumps. If unregulated, this can cause pipe bursts or tank leaks.

Haier uses an 8-bar rated system in its water heaters. It also includes a Multi-Function Safety Valve that performs multiple roles. This safety valve in a water heater releases extra pressure, prevents backflow, and drains excess water safely. This system eliminates the need for external plumbing support.

Why Does IPX4 Water Resistance Matter for Bathroom Water Heaters?

Electrical appliances in bathrooms are exposed to humidity, steam, and accidental splashes. That is why Haier has added IPX4 water resistance to its ESTILE model. It prevents moisture from entering the body of the heater. This protects the wiring and circuit board.

It also stops short circuits triggered by external moisture or seepage. This also means that the product can be safely installed in smaller bathrooms or shared wash areas with limited spacing. The risk of water contact does not compromise its performance.

Which Tank and Heating Element Materials Make a Water Heater Safer and More Durable?

Haier’s tank is not just a metal container. It is enamel-coated to resist corrosion and hard water damage. Over time, rust is one of the biggest enemies of water heater safety features. Rust weakens the tank walls and allows heat to escape, raising the risk of overheating.

The ESTILE model comes with a Corrosion Proof UMC Tank and a magnesium rod that controls scale formation. The Incoloy 800SS Heating Element is resistant to high temperatures and has longer durability than standard copper elements.
